I think you actually explained in your response why it was a bad look. Flores accused the Dolphins of using him as an Uncle Tom to meet a quota, and the moment the team was good again they’d dump him for another (presumably white) coach, and specifically Sean Payton. If the Dolphins actually sign Sean Payton and trade for Brady’s rights / sign him after Brady gets Tampa to release him from him contract, then it plays out exactly as Flores predicted ahead of time - potentially adding legitimacy to his claim in the public’s eye. Instead, the Dolphins stop all pursuit of both…. And then they hire a mixed-race coach who looks white, such that the Dolphins then publicly exclaim that it’s someone of color. Which has the impact of deflating Flores’ claims since they replaced him with another person of color. I think it’s pretty clear that the Flores situation made the Dolphins change their plans. Should they have? That’s a different question, but it’s quite clear that they did.

There were tampering punishments involving pick swaps benefitting the "victim" team in 2008 and 2011 (Lance Briggs and Jarrad Page). The Eagles did not get a pick when the Chiefs tampered with Jeremy Maclin in 2016 (forfeited 3rd and 6th). Similarly, the Patriots did not get any picks when the Jets tampered with Revis (fine only) or Brady (forfeited 1st and 3rd). Of those five, only Revis actually joined the team that tampered with him.
